当前位置 主页 > 技术大全 >

    VMware虚拟机:映像文件丢失解决指南
    vmware虚拟机找不到映像

    栏目:技术大全 时间:2025-03-11 14:53



    解决VMware虚拟机找不到映像的终极指南 在虚拟化技术日益普及的今天,VMware凭借其强大的功能和灵活性,成为了众多企业和个人用户的首选

        然而,在使用VMware虚拟机的过程中,有时会遇到一个令人头疼的问题——虚拟机找不到映像文件

        这个问题不仅会影响工作效率,还可能导致重要数据的丢失

        本文将深入探讨VMware虚拟机找不到映像的原因、影响及解决方案,帮助读者快速有效地解决这一问题

         一、VMware虚拟机找不到映像的现象与影响 在使用VMware创建或启动虚拟机时,如果系统提示找不到映像文件(通常是.vmx、.vmdk等文件),用户将无法进行虚拟机的正常操作

        这一现象可能表现为以下几种形式: 1.启动失败:虚拟机无法正常启动,屏幕上显示错误消息,指出无法找到或加载指定的映像文件

         2.配置错误:在VMware Workstation或VMware ESXi的管理界面中,虚拟机的配置信息显示不完整或错误,提示映像文件丢失

         3.性能下降:在某些情况下,即使虚拟机勉强启动,由于映像文件不完整或路径错误,可能导致虚拟机运行缓慢、频繁崩溃或无法访问存储的数据

         这一问题的影响不容小觑

        对于依赖虚拟机进行日常工作的用户而言,它不仅会导致工作流程中断,还可能引发数据丢失、项目延误等严重后果

        在企业环境中,虚拟机映像文件的丢失还可能涉及敏感信息泄露、业务连续性受损等高风险问题

         二、VMware虚拟机找不到映像的原因分析 VMware虚拟机找不到映像文件的原因多种多样,以下是一些常见的原因: 1.文件路径错误:在创建或配置虚拟机时,如果指定的映像文件路径不正确,或者后续移动了文件位置而未更新路径,就会导致虚拟机找不到映像

         2.文件损坏:硬盘故障、病毒感染、不当操作等都可能导致虚拟机映像文件损坏,从而无法被正常读取

         3.权限问题:在某些操作系统中,如果当前用户没有足够的权限访问虚拟机映像文件所在的目录,也会导致虚拟机无法加载这些文件

         4.快照管理不当:在使用VMware的快照功能时,如果快照管理不当(如频繁创建快照而不合并,或删除快照时出错),可能导致虚拟机映像文件状态混乱,进而无法找到正确的文件

         5.存储问题:虚拟机所在的存储介质(如硬盘、网络存储等)出现问题,如连接中断、存储空间不足等,也可能导致虚拟机无法访问其映像文件

         三、解决VMware虚拟机找不到映像的详细步骤 针对上述原因,以下是一套详细的解决方案,旨在帮助用户快速定位并解决问题: 1. 检查文件路径 - 步骤一:打开VMware Workstation或VMware ESXi的管理界面,找到出问题的虚拟机

         - 步骤二:检查虚拟机的配置文件(.vmx文件),确认其中记录的映像文件路径是否正确

         - 步骤三:如果路径错误,手动更正为正确的文件路径,并保存配置

         步骤四:重启虚拟机,查看问题是否解决

         2. 验证文件完整性 - 步骤一:使用文件管理器或命令行工具,检查虚拟机映像文件(如.vmdk文件)是否存在且未被损坏

         - 步骤二:如果文件缺失或损坏,尝试从备份中恢复,或重新下载/创建映像文件

         - 步骤三:如果无法恢复,考虑重新创建虚拟机并迁移数据

         3. 调整权限设置 - 步骤一:确保当前用户具有访问虚拟机映像文件所在目录的权限

         - 步骤二:在文件系统中,右键点击目标文件夹,选择“属性”,然后在“安全”选项卡中检查并修改权限设置

         - 步骤三:重启VMware服务或计算机,再次尝试启动虚拟机

         4. 管理快照 - 步骤一:进入虚拟机的快照管理器,查看当前快照状态

         - 步骤二:如果快照过多或存在异常,尝试合并快照或删除不必要的快照

         - 步骤三:在进行快照操作前,建议备份虚拟机以防万一

         - 步骤四:操作完成后,重启虚拟机检查问题是否解决

         5. 检查存储问题 - 步骤一:确认虚拟机所在的存储介质连接正常,无物理损坏或连接中断现象

         - 步骤二:检查存储空间是否充足,必要时清理无用数据或扩展存储空间

         - 步骤三:如果是网络存储,检查网络连接状态及存储服务器的运行状态

         - 步骤四:根据存储介质的具体问题,采取相应的修复措施

         四、预防措施与最佳实践 为了避免VMware虚拟机找不到映像的问题再次发生,建议采取以下预防措施和最佳实践: - 定期备份:定期备份虚拟机及其配置文件,确保在出现问题时能够快速恢复

         - 谨慎操作:在移动、重命名或删除虚拟机文件时,务必小心谨慎,避免误操作导致文件丢失或路径错误

         - 合理管理快照:定期合并快照,避免快照过多导致虚拟机性能下降或管理混乱

         - 监控存储状态:定期检查存储介质的健康状况和剩余空间,及时采取措施解决潜在问题

         - 权限管理:合理配置文件系统权限,确保虚拟机运行所需的文件和目录对用户可访问

         五、结语 VMware虚拟机找不到映像的问题虽然复杂,但通过细致的分析和有效的解决方案,我们完全有能力克服这一挑战

        本文不仅提供了针对该问题的详细解决步骤,还强调了预防措施和最佳实践的重要性

        希望每位读者都能从中受益,确保自己的虚拟机环境稳定、高效运行

        在未来的虚拟化技术发展中,让我们共同期待更加智能、便捷的解决方案,为工作和生活带来更多便利